Hey Dave, I may have the variety of it for you. Kinda hard to tell from pictures, but I think it's a Breen's variety 1313 (feeling unlucky? lol) A.K.A Crosby Pl. VII and Newman 15-Y Should say States United with an 8 sided star in a recessed circle between the words, at both 12 and 6 o'clock position. It also should have a die crack on the sundial side from a little above the 5 o'clock position of the sundial to the edge of the coin. It's listed as Scarce :clapping: That's the best guess I can give you without seeing it in hand under a magnifying glass.
